Meeting Ozzy Osbourne
Thelma’s life took a significant turn in 1971 when she met Ozzy Osbourne. At the time, she was working as a waitress in the Rum Runner nightclub in Birmingham, an epicenter for the city’s lively music scene. Ozzy, at the cusp of major stardom with Black Sabbath, was a frequent visitor to the club. Their meeting sparked a connection that quickly deepened, leading them to tie the knot within the same year they met.

Marriage to Ozzy Osbourne
Thelma and Ozzy’s marriage began in 1971 and lasted until 1982. During these years, Thelma became a stepmother to Ozzy’s adopted son, Elliot Kingsley, and they had two children of their own: Jessica Starshine Osbourne and Louis John Osbourne. The marriage was fraught with challenges, notably Ozzy’s burgeoning fame and his lifestyle, which was marked by extensive touring and struggles with substance abuse. These issues placed a significant strain on their relationship, ultimately leading to their divorce.

Life After Divorce
Following her separation from Ozzy, Thelma chose to step back from the tumult of celebrity life and focused on her personal well-being and career. She continued her profession as a school teacher in Leicestershire, where she found stability and fulfillment away from the public eye.
